## Authentication

Heads up: the nightly reindex job (`reindex_nightly.py`) talks to the Lanternfish search cluster, and that cluster won't accept anonymous writes anymore — we locked it down last sprint. The job now authenticates as the `reindex-runner` service identity against Corvid Gateway, and the token is injected via the `LF_INDEX_TOKEN` env var in the scheduler config. Nothing clever going on, just a bearer header on every batch request. For review purposes, the staging credential currently in use is listed below.

service key, kadug-kadup: kto15_rN23XLAYImmZgrJ

Wiki: Budget Request — Helix Works (Managers Only). Facilities has requested additional capital for the Stonegate lab refit: new ventilation, two test benches, and security upgrades. The ask exceeds the discretionary ceiling, so department heads must co-endorse before it reaches the steering committee. Comments close Thursday. The urgency stems from plans outlined in the confidential note below.

management briefing: The finance team signed off on a budget of $30.7 million for Project Istion. The renewal with Ulaixox Partners closes at $15.3 million a year, 52 percent below the last contract.

## Runbook: Sort Stability in Glimmerboard Report Builder

Heads up: exports from Glimmerboard can shuffle rows with equal sort keys because the backend switched to an unstable quicksort in the v4 rollout. Users see "random" ordering between refreshes. Workaround until the stable-sort patch ships: add a tiebreaker column (row ID works) in the report config, or flip the `stable_sort` flag via the admin API. To toggle the flag on a tenant, call the internal config endpoint and authenticate with the key below.

gateway credential: kto23_LX9A4ys6i4nzHtpOLNLodKK